Transaction 51839dc8ca29821ec5f24faec20c6677777eb17fdcc4d315b23c0d19e0fe3310
1 Input
1 Output
-
51839dc8ca29821ec5f24faec20c6677777eb17fdcc4d315b23c0d19e0fe3310:0
- value
- 498560924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9211267f068a4d9c14c17a067e234f50bccda25f OP_EQUAL
- address
- 3F1M8BPkWAQmvjpRq6whiBygV6XsBUkNxK